    Hi @Bemused

    Have you checked your Tado bridge is still connected to the internet ??🤔

    Your Schedule information is saved to the cloud/servers.......if no connection.....no schedules.

  • It says there is a connection, but I assume if there is no connection then I wouldn't be able to change the temperature manually from my phone or would I ?
  • Looks like I may have sorted it. The bridge was connected to the internet but my phone wasn't paired to it. Now it's paired it seems to be working fine from the schedule 👍

  • banny
    banny
    edited February 2023
    I had the same problem. It was caused by my daughter's phone being with her (she doesn't live with us) and her being a 'user' in the app. I removed her and the schedule worked.
